As a business, am I responsible for enforcing this bylaw?

You’re responsible for enforcing the provincial law, which bans smoking within five metres (16 feet) from your doorways or openable windows. You are not required to enforce the Town of Banff bylaw. Businesses are not allowed to designate smoking areas in the public places prohibited by this bylaw.
